Abstract
The present disclosure provides vaccine compositions comprising at least one adjuvant and at least one antigen, wherein the adjuvant is a cationic lipid. The disclosure also provides methods of treating a disease in a mammal, methods of preventing a disease in a mammal, and methods of effecting antigen cross presentation to induce a humoral immune response and a cellular immune response in a mammal utilizing the vaccine compositions. Cross presentation of various antigens can be achieved by formulating the specific antigens with cationic lipids possessing adjuvant properties.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1 . A vaccine composition comprising at least one adjuvant and at least one pathogenic antigen, wherein the adjuvant is a cationic lipid.
2 . The vaccine composition of claim 1 wherein the cationic lipid is a non-steroidal cationic lipid.
3 . The vaccine composition of claim 1 wherein the cationic lipid is selected from the group consisting of DOTAP, DOTMA, DOEPC, and combinations thereof.
4 . The vaccine composition of claim 1 wherein the adjuvant is an enantiomer of the cationic lipid.
5 . The vaccine composition of claim 4 wherein the enantiomer is R-DOTAP or S-DOTAP.
6 . The vaccine composition of claim 1 wherein one or more antigens is a viral antigen.
7 . The vaccine composition of claim 1 wherein one or more antigens is a bacterial or fungal antigen.
8 . The vaccine composition of claim 1 wherein at least one antigen is an antigen from a conserved region of a pathogen.
9 . The vaccine composition of claim 8 wherein the vaccine composition is a universal vaccine.
10 . The vaccine composition of claim 7 wherein the vaccine composition is an influenza vaccine, and wherein the influenza vaccine comprises a glycoprotein antigen found on the surface of an influenza virus.
11 . The vaccine composition of claim 10 wherein the antigen is a hemagglutinin antigen.
12 . The vaccine composition of claim 11 wherein the hemagglutinin antigen comprises an epitope region HA 818-526 .
13 . The vaccine composition of claim 10 wherein the influenza vaccine is a neuraminidase subunit vaccine.
14 . A method of effecting antigen cross presentation to induce a humoral immune response and a cellular immune response in a mammal, said method comprising the step of administering an effective amount of a vaccine composition to the mammal, wherein the vaccine composition comprises at least one adjuvant and at least one antigen, and wherein the adjuvant is a cationic lipid.
15 . The method of claim 14 wherein the humoral immune response is an antibody response.
16 . The method of claim 14 wherein the cellular immune response is a T cell response.
17 . The method of claim 16 wherein the T cell response is a CD 8+ T cell response.
18 . The method of claim 14 wherein the cationic lipid is a non-steroidal cationic lipid.
19 . The method of claim 14 wherein the cationic lipid is selected from the group consisting of DOTAP, DOTMA, DOEPC, and combinations thereof.
20 . The method of claim 14 wherein the adjuvant is an enantiomer of a cationic lipid.
